ubuntu

Java编译时Ubuntu提示缺少什么

小樊
37
2025-06-03 03:33:42
栏目: 编程语言

在Ubuntu上编译Java程序时,如果遇到提示缺少某些东西,通常可能是以下几种情况:

  1. 缺少Java开发工具包(JDK):确保已经安装了JDK。可以使用以下命令安装:
sudo apt update
sudo apt install openjdk-11-jdk
  1. 缺少Java编译器(javac):确保已经安装了Java编译器。可以使用以下命令安装:
sudo apt install openjdk-11-jdk-headless
  1. 缺少类库或依赖:确保已经安装了所需的类库和依赖。可以使用aptmvn(如果使用Maven)来安装所需的依赖。

  2. 缺少环境变量配置:确保已经正确配置了JAVA_HOME和PATH环境变量。可以使用以下命令设置:

export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
export PATH=$PATH:$JAVA_HOME/bin

为了使这些设置在每次打开终端时生效,请将它们添加到~/.bashrc文件中。

  1. 编译命令错误:确保使用正确的编译命令。例如,如果要编译名为HelloWorld.java的文件,可以使用以下命令:
javac HelloWorld.java

如果仍然遇到问题,请提供更详细的错误信息,以便更好地解决问题。

0
看了该问题的人还看了